Verse (39:59), Word 4 - Quranic Grammar

__

The fourth word of verse (39:59) is divided into 2 morphological segments. A noun and possessive pronoun. The noun is feminine plural and is in the nominative case (مرفوع). The noun's triliteral root is hamza yā yā (أ ي ي). The attached possessive pronoun is first person singular.

Chapter (39) sūrat l-zumar (The Groups)


(39:59:4)
āyātī
My Verses,
N – nominative feminine plural noun
PRON – 1st person singular possessive pronoun
اسم مرفوع والياء ضمير متصل في محل جر بالاضافة

Verse (39:59)

The analysis above refers to the 59th verse of chapter 39 (sūrat l-zumar):

Sahih International: But yes, there had come to you My verses, but you denied them and were arrogant, and you were among the disbelievers.
